Treatment of surface water inoculated with Aspergillus species using ultraviolet radiation and photocatalytic membrane reactors

Resumo:"Limited attention has been given to the presence of fungi in the aquatic environment when compared to other microorganisms such as bacteria and virus. Our previous research showed that fungi occur widely in drinking water sources and described many fungi species that have not been previously reported in the aquatic environment. Moreover, many filamentous fungi species present in water were found to be able to grow at high temperatures and have conidia measurements lower than 5 µm, being therefore considered as potential pathogenic species to humans and animals.
